How Public Testing for Google AI Search is Rolling Out
The public testing for Google AI Search is designed to be inclusive, targeting US subscribers of Google One AI Premium through an easy opt-in process in Google Labs. This isn’t just a trial—it’s a collaborative effort where user feedback drives improvements in speed, quality, and reliability. By involving a broader audience, Google aims to iron out any kinks, ensuring Google AI Search becomes a trustworthy staple for daily use.

Balancing Innovation and Trust in Google AI Search
As Google rolls out more features for Google AI Search, maintaining trust is paramount. The company addresses concerns about misinformation by only presenting AI-generated responses when they’re highly confident, otherwise reverting to standard web results. This careful balance ensures users can rely on Google AI Search without second-guessing its accuracy.
Sundar Pichai, Google’s CEO, puts it well: user feedback is the guiding force. It’s about creating tools that not only innovate but also build confidence, which is essential as Google AI Search becomes more integrated into our routines.
“We want to innovate, and so I think this allows us to do that… But the true north through all of this is user feedback, user satisfaction, user experience.” – Sundar Pichai [4]
Early Reactions to Google AI Search and Its Growing Adoption
User adoption of Google AI Search has been impressive, with over 1.5 billion interactions with AI Overviews monthly across 100+ countries. People are gravitating towards personalized recommendations and visual searches, highlighting the appeal of Google AI Search in practical scenarios like online shopping.
Surveys reveal that nearly half of consumers use AI tools for purchases, appreciating how Google AI Search tailors results. Yet, about 70% express caution about its trustworthiness— a reminder that as Google AI Search evolves, transparency will be key to winning hearts.

Comparing Google AI Search to Traditional Methods
Feature | Google AI Search | Traditional Search |
---|---|---|
Response Format | Summarized, conversational, and multimodal | Simple lists of links and snippets |
Complex Query Handling | Manages contextual, multi-step queries effortlessly | Requires manual refinement and multiple searches |
Follow-Up Support | Enables threaded conversations for better flow | Demands new queries each time |
Visual Content | Incorporates images, videos, and charts seamlessly | Largely text-focused with optional images |
Personalization | Delivers tailored, context-aware results | Offers limited personalization options |
Error Management | Switches to web results when needed for accuracy | Leaves error checking to the user |

SEO Strategies in the Era of Google AI Search
Optimizing for Google AI Search involves creating content that’s helpful, original, and aligned with user intent. Focus on conversational queries and ensure your site uses structured data to stand out.
- Prioritize original, intent-driven content that Google AI Search can highlight effectively.
- Optimize for featured snippets to increase visibility in Google AI Search results.
- Incorporate multimedia like images and videos to enhance appeal in Google AI Search formats.
- Maintain strong technical SEO, such as fast load times, to support seamless integration with Google AI Search.
- Stay updated with Google’s guidelines to leverage the full potential of Google AI Search.
Google emphasizes that AI-generated content isn’t a penalty if it’s useful and accurate, making this an exciting time for SEO pros.
